Sun in Taurus (Surya in Vrishabha)
Mild malefic · Earth · Sthira · ruled by Venus
The Sun in Taurus is in an enemy's sign. Taurus is ruled by Venus, and the Sun counts Venus an enemy.
The relationship runs both ways: the Sun counts Venus an enemy, and Venus counts the Sun an enemy. A mutual reading is the simpler case — the graha and its host agree about each other, so the placement does not change character depending on which of the two is stronger.
Taurus is a sthira earth sign governing the face, neck and throat, and the Sun is reckoned mild malefic, governing soul, ego, vitality, leadership, father. Whatever the Sun signifies — father, government, authority, the soul (atma), medicine, administration — is what this rashi’s fixity holds in place.
The Dignity, Stated Precisely
- In Taurus: in an enemy's sign.
- The Sun’s own sign: Leo.
- Exalted in: Aries, deepest at 10°.
- Debilitated in: Libra.
- Moolatrikona: Leo 0°–20°.
- Taurus’s lord: Venus. Taurus exalts Moon at 3° and debilitates no graha.
What the Sun Aspects From Taurus
Every graha casts a full aspect on the 7th house from itself, and the Sun has no special drishti beyond it, so the 7th is the whole of its reach. Counting from Taurus, that lands on:
- 7th from Taurus → Scorpio (Vrishchika), ruled by Mars.
Scorpio is not one of the Sun’s own rashis, so the single aspect the Sun throws from Taurus lands on Mars’s territory. Whose territory it is decides how the aspect is received.

The Company the Sun Keeps in Taurus
Dignity runs in both directions, and the rashi has its own roster. Taurus runs from 30°00′ to 60°00′ of sidereal longitude — the arc the Sun crosses about May 15 – Jun 14 — faces south, is classed female, and as an earth sign is of the Vaishya varna. Within those thirty degrees:
- Ruled by Venus.
- Exalts Moon at 3° — not the Sun, so the strongest single degree of Taurus is not the Sun’s.
- Debilitates no graha. No graha reaches its lowest point inside Taurus.
- Moolatrikona of Moon, 4°–30°.
So Taurus carries a fixed dignity point inside it, and the closer the Sun sits to that degree the more the reading is dominated by it rather than by the sign as a whole. Taurus’s own traits — reliable, patient, devoted, stubborn, sensual — are the register in which soul, ego, vitality, leadership, father gets expressed when the Sun sits here.
The Nine Padas the Sun Crosses in Taurus
A rashi is thirty degrees and a pada is three degrees twenty minutes, so every sign holds exactly nine padas — never a round number of nakshatras. Taurus holds 3 nakshatras in whole or in part: Krittika (padas 2, 3, 4), Rohini and Mrigashira (padas 1, 2).
| Pada | Sidereal longitude | Nakshatra | Lord | Navamsa |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| 30°00′–33°20′ | Krittika pada 2 | Sun ← | Capricorn |
| 2 | 33°20′–36°40′ | Krittika pada 3 | Sun ← | Aquarius |
| 3 | 36°40′–40°00′ | Krittika pada 4 | Sun ← | Pisces |
| 4 | 40°00′–43°20′ | Rohini pada 1 | Moon | Aries |
| 5 | 43°20′–46°40′ | Rohini pada 2 | Moon | Taurus |
| 6 | 46°40′–50°00′ | Rohini pada 3 | Moon | Gemini |
| 7 | 50°00′–53°20′ | Rohini pada 4 | Moon | Cancer |
| 8 | 53°20′–56°40′ | Mrigashira pada 1 | Mars | Leo |
| 9 | 56°40′–60°00′ | Mrigashira pada 2 | Mars | Virgo |
The Sun rules Krittika, Uttara Phalguni, Uttara Ashadha, and one of them falls inside Taurus: Krittika (padas 2, 3, 4). Those degrees are the part of Taurus where the Sun is on its own ground regardless of what the sign lord thinks of it — a nakshatra lordship is a second, finer layer of dignity, and it does not have to agree with the first. That matters here, because it gives the Sun a foothold in a sign whose lord it counts an enemy.

Reading the Sun in Taurus
The Sun signifies father, government, authority, the soul (atma), medicine, administration. In Taurus those significations are filtered through a sthira earth sign ruled by Venus, and the dignity above says how much support they get in the process. In an enemy’s sign they meet resistance from the host, and the results tend to arrive late or in a form the native did not ask for.
This is not a prediction, and it cannot be one: the house Taurus occupies from the ascendant, which of the nine padas above holds the graha, and the running dasha all change the answer. The Sun is reckoned mild malefic, and it gains in the 1st, 5th, 9th, 10th and 11th while it struggles in the 4th, 7th and 12th — so Sun in Taurus is a different placement in each of them.
